Lemon Mug Cake Recipe

A light and fluffy lemon mug cake made in minutes with fresh lemon juice and zest. Perfect for a quick, refreshing dessert.

  • Total Time: 5 minutes
  • Yield: 1 serving 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 tablespoons all-purpose flour

  • 2 tablespoons sugar

  • 1/4 teaspoon baking powder

  • Pinch of salt

  • 3 tablespoons milk

  • 2 tablespoons vegetable oil or melted butter

  • 1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ice

  • 1/2 teaspoon lemon zest

  • 1/4 teaspoon vanilla extract

Instructions

  • In a microwave-safe mug, combine fl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t.

  • Mix the dry ingredients well.

  • Add milk, oil, lemon juice, lemon zest, and vanilla extract.

  • Stir until smooth and lump-free.

  • Microwave on high for 60–90 seconds.

  • Let the cake cool slightly before eating.

  • Add toppings like powdered sugar or glaze if desired.

Notes

  • Use fresh lemon juice for the best flavor.

  • Avoid overcooking to keep the cake soft.

  • Let the cake rest for 1 minute after microwaving.

  • Add a simple lemon glaze for extra sweetness.
